Yes—Welcome to 501-503 & 505-511 Laguna Street, a rare two-building opportunity in one of San Francisco’s most walk-able and high-visibility neighborhoods. Located at the corner of Laguna and Fell streets, this mixed-use corner investment in Hayes Valley offers diversified income, future potential, and standout location value.
The property includes two (2) separate buildings on separate parcels with established commercial tenants: DOMO SUSHI, IL BORGO RESTAURANT, HAHDOUGH BAKERY, and AT&T COMMUNICATIONS. These long-term occupants reflect strong foot traffic, brand recognition, and neighborhood integration.
Upstairs are six (6) residential units, fully occupied with historically low turnover. Professional management, stabilized rents and well-maintained systems create a turnkey asset for investors seeking immediate income with minimal oversight.
